Transaction 2830830f564ac34e8d5be2656f5f22f796e08b527d825e3e3193e71e4a52ba72

1 Input
2 Outputs
  • 2830830f564ac34e8d5be2656f5f22f796e08b527d825e3e3193e71e4a52ba72:0
  • value  183000
    address  3FA6xpDUmAtfyPHc9ruzmookwKARLRjhFu
  • 2830830f564ac34e8d5be2656f5f22f796e08b527d825e3e3193e71e4a52ba72:1
  • value  676263125
    address  1E8yAjgb26xKev1jpYtjSrfPxywrKsRdJ4